Here2Help Business
Worcestershire County Council has launched a new £3m programme to assist local businesses to recover, adapt, develop and support future resilience as lockdown measures reduce.
Open 4 Business Funding Finder
With the effects of the COVID-19 pandemic, businesses are increasingly needing funding to support their business. To support with current pressures and the need to find precise and relevant funding information, our partners Worcestershire County Council are providing access to the Open 4 Business portal until 31 October 2020.
